Tanea Robinson, Ed.D. ’01

Tanea Robinson posing with a scholarship recipient

Dr. Tanea Robinson's service to the Alumni Association has made a lasting impact among both students and alumni. From 2023 to 2025, she served on the Alumni Board of Directors and, most recently, she chaired the Alumni Scholarship Committee, overseeing the selection process and awarding of $40,000 in scholarships to deserving students.

Dr. Robinson received her undergraduate degree in child development from Cal State LA in 2001. She is currently an instructor with the UCLA Extension Pathways Program, working with postsecondary students who identify as neurodiverse, and an adjunct faculty member at Santiago Canyon College. 2025-2026 Alumni Scholarship Recognition Dinner

Guests seated and standing at the 2025 Alumni Scholarship Dinner

Friends, loved ones, and members of the Alumni Scholarship Committee and the Alumni Association Board of Directors gathered on Oct. 28 to celebrate the 2025–2026 Alumni Scholarship recipients and their achievements.

This year’s inspiring group of scholars stood out among more than 1,800 applicants who applied for an Alumni Scholarship. In total, 40 recipients were selected, each receiving a $1,000 award in recognition of their academic excellence, leadership, and service.


Nursing Alumni Network Brunch

People seated and standing outside under blue skies

The Nursing Alumni Network rekindled Golden Eagle pride at their Oct. 4 brunch, where alumni, students, faculty, and friends reconnected, welcomed new leadership, and strengthened ties within the Los Angeles nursing community.

Guests had the opportunity to tour the Yoshie and Yoshiharu Ohara Virtual and Augmented Reality Immersive Learning Center and the Patricia A. Chin School of Nursing Simulation Center, featuring high-fidelity manikins that simulate real-life care scenarios, ranging from birthing to vital signs monitoring.

This event marked a new chapter for the network, fostering opportunities for mentorship and collaboration.


CLUAN x Aída Cuevas

Group of people milling around in front of green hedges with a sign that says Cal State L.A.

The Chicanx Latinx University Alumni Network (CLUAN) welcomed the greater Cal State LA community to a special evening at the Luckman Fine Arts Complex, featuring Aída Cuevas, the Queen of Ranchera Music.

Before the Sept. 28 show, 100 lucky alumni and their guests were treated to an exclusive pre-reception and explored The Luckman Gallery’s Layered Legacies exhibition, featuring works by iconic artists including Frida Kahlo, Diego Rivera, Salvador Dalí, and more.
